Commercial Waste Management Tips for Burlington, IL

Should my business use a commercial waste compactor?

If you own a commercial property and generate a large volume of compactable material (or you have limited space for collecting waste), you should seriously consider utilizing a trash compactor if you aren't doing so already.

Using a commercial waste compactor has multiple advantages:

  • Greatly reduces waste management costs
  • Minimizes the chances of developing a pest problem
  • Improves the overall appearance of the property

Compactors can come in a variety of shapes and sizes, allowing them to meet a range of commercial waste needs, including vertical compactors, apartment compactors, and roll-off compactors (stationary or breakaway).

What size commercial dumpsters are available?

Commercial waste containers come in a number of sizes, most commonly ranging from 1 cubic yard to 8 cubic yards and some of the most popular sizes being 2 yard, 4 yard, and 6 yard. These size variations enable companies to choose the perfect size dumpster for their business’ specific needs.
